| 0:00.0 | You're listening to the Gold Digger podcast episode number 216. |
| 0:05.0 | Lauren Navier is a brilliant makeup artist that's made a name for herself with |
| 0:10.2 | tenacity and grit. To put it simply, her works have been seen in Vogue, Vanity Fair, |
| 0:15.2 | and on ABC's long-running Today Show and their late-night comedy institution, |
| 0:20.1 | you might have heard of before Saturday Night Live. She's worked with some of the most |
| 0:24.8 | famous celebrities, including Academy Award winners, Olympic gold medalists, |
| 0:29.6 | a beetle, even an American president. But with all of that service-based success, |
| 0:35.2 | she transitioned to a product-based business and is killing it with her |
| 0:39.6 | makeup-remover products. Today, Lauren is going to teach us the pros and cons of |
| 0:44.4 | both service-based industries and product-based industries, how she transitioned |
| 0:48.8 | in her career and kept a really awesome clientele what the trickiest parts have |
| 0:54.0 | been in starting a product-based business and how you can master both success as a |
| 0:59.6 | service-based or a product-based business. This episode is really valuable and I |
| 1:04.9 | just love the way that she is a powerhouse. It's so evident in every word she |
